How HPLC Testing Works
HPLC testing separates compounds in a liquid sample using a pressurized mobile phase, a chemically selective column, and a detector. This article explains the workflow, instrumentation, data interpretation, and quality controls behind reliable HPLC analysis.

Understanding Peptide Purity Percentages
Peptide purity percentages are commonly reported by HPLC, but they do not always represent peptide content or biological activity. Understanding how purity is measured helps researchers choose suitable materials and interpret experimental results.
